

Sugarbush Vermont is picture postcard perfect. You’ve seen the
Clydesdale ad, with the horse drawn sleigh gliding over fresh
sparkling snow. That popular clip was filmed in the beautiful mad
River Valley.
The setting of rolling snow-covered mountains, the backdrop to church
steeples and quaint New England towns, is only one reason to go.
Two ski mountains on one ticket, Glen Ellen and Lincoln Peak make up
Sugarbush's vast Vermont skiing. Sugarbush is the only Eastern
resort to offer cat skiing in their outback Slide Brook area.
Sugarbush is a great choice for a family ski vacation. The scenery is
beautiful, the slopeside Clay Brook Inn, as seen on the Today Show, is
perfectly situated at the base of Lincoln Peak. The Mad
River Valley has a classic Vermont town with
charming inns, covered bridges and country stores galore.
Sugarbush Stats:
Vertical Drop: 2,600’
Skiable Terrain: 508 acres
21 Lifts, 111 Trails
70% snowmaking
Founded in 1958
